Yes but I find it weird that they are giving out codes that let people join on headstart. Headstart was supposed to be Pre-order exclusive but even now we may see '' free loaders '' in there, as in people who were never going to even buy the game. Most people who are interested in TERA would have preordered it by now anyway so what's the point of these codes?
The way I see it, its for people who have a bunch of friends who haven't heard of the game, or aren't all that interested. Its an opportunity to get players to try out the game with the added incentive that unlike betas, you keep the character(s) if you end up paying for the game.

For example, you show your three friends who are on the fence, or weren't interested/ haven't heard of the game yet. Let's say they all decide to try and you party up with them, By the end of the head start period, perhaps you are all level 20. (Maybe they are slow levelers like me ) Now they might enjoy the game, but also with an incentive to keep playing with you as you will be continuing after launch. Unlike the betas, where you can simply toss away the character since it will be wiped, there is more connection when it is a character that won't be wiped if the purchase/subscription is made.

Quote:
Set up your subscription before May 31, 2012 at 11:59 PM PST to receive discounted inaugural pricing below:

Monthly Subscription: $14.99
3-month Subscription: $35.85 ($11.95/month = 20% discount)
6-month Subscription: $59.70 ($9.95/month = 34% discount)
Yearly Subscription: $107.40 ($8.95/month = 40% discount)

Beginning June 1, 2012, at 12:00 AM PST, the pricing will change to the normal rate:

Monthly Subscription: $14.99
3-month Subscription: $38.85 ($12.95/month = 14% discount)
6-month Subscription: $65.70 ($10.95/month = 27% discount)
Yearly Subscription: $119.40 ($9.95/month = 34% discount)
Still good prices when comparing to WoW subscription fees. I'll give this game a shot when I get more free time and money.
